lonesock wrote:That is strange. I've looked over the settings, everything seems great. (The only thing I think I would change is the Destring triggering values. I use 2.5 for the Min Jump, and 10 for the trigger. KISSlicer will already trigger a destring event if the head moves across (or even gets too near) a perimeter. If it destrings all the time it's harder on the extruder, and it's actually tough to get the perfect amt of filament deposited when it's constantly being suddenly pulled around. [8^)

I am assuming you still get good prints with that same material and temperature with KISSlicer 1.5, or other slicers.

When you measure the thickness of a vase print, is the wall thickness exactly what you would expect?

I notice from the pics that there are a couple of places where I see some browning, like maybe the temperature is a bit too high for the plastic? (Btw, I used to print a bunch in ABS, but since finding ASA I have totally switched...I love the finish and the UV-resistance is great too.)

I just noticed the Z-lift in the video. 0.5 is a pretty large Z-lift, and Z travel is slow. If you can get away with 0 that would be ideal, but if that knocks over prints and such, I would use your average layer thickness. I usually run 0.2 for my Z-lift when needed on materials that tend to blob or string more (PLA, PETG, Nylon), and 0.1 or less for stiff materials like HIPS. (Also, can your Z-speed be increased safely?)
